About Hawaii Community College

Hawaii Community College is a public two-year institution located in Hilo, HI. The college enrolls 3,034 students (IPEDS 2023) and holds a quality score of 35.67 out of 100. Its completion rate is 32% (IPEDS 2023), with a retention rate of 59% (IPEDS 2023).

The college offers a wide variety of technical and trades certificate programs. Construction and automotive programs include Carpentry, Autobody/Collision and Repair Technology, Welding Technology, High Performance and Custom Engine Technician, and Architectural Drafting and CAD/CADD. Electrical programs include Electrical/Electronic and Communications Engineering Technology and Electrician. Healthcare offerings include Registered Nursing. Creative programs include Animation, Interactive Technology, Video Graphics, and Special Effects.

Situated on the Big Island of Hawaii, Hawaii Community College serves a geographically distinct student population with technical education programs that support the island's construction, automotive, healthcare, and creative industries.

Accreditation: Accrediting Commission for Community and Junior Colleges
